Columbia Central High School is a public high school located in Brooklyn, Michigan. The school serves about 650 students in grades 7 to 12. [ 1 ] It is part of the Columbia School District.

Brooklyn is a village in Jackson County in the U.S. state of Michigan. The population was 1,313 at the 2020 census. It is located in the Irish Hills region of southern Michigan, just north of U.S. Route 12 along M-50. The village is located within Columbia Township. Michigan International Speedway is just to its south in Cambridge Township.
